Trivia

What it actually is

  • Spectral class. Its spectrum reads A8IV — an A-type star: white-hot, typically about twice the Sun's mass, and the class most of the sky's famous bright stars belong to.
  • Where it is in life. It is a subgiant, caught in the act of leaving the main sequence as the hydrogen in its core runs out.

Sense of scale

  • In perspective. Far away by human standards, yet still a local address inside the Milky Way's spiral arms.

Find it in the sky

  • How to spot it. At magnitude 6.1 it is just past naked-eye reach — ordinary binoculars will pull it in, over in Leo.
  • Northern sky. It rides the northern half of the sky — an easier target the further north you are.
  • Best time of year. It stands highest in the middle of the night around February — that's when to go looking.

About 20 Leo

20 Leo is a common star. It lies about 624.8 light-years from Earth, sits in the constellation Leo, shines at apparent magnitude 6.1 and has spectral type A8IV.

Its spectrum reads A8IV — an A-type star: white-hot, typically about twice the Sun's mass, and the class most of the sky's famous bright stars belong to.

How to see it

Look for 20 Leo in the constellation Leo. At apparent magnitude 6.1, it is an easy target for binoculars.
